Understanding the Unique Characteristics of the Eye Area

The speaker emphasizes that the skin around the eyes differs significantly from the rest of the face. Two key characteristics are highlighted:

  1. Reduced Sebaceous Gland Activity: The eye area possesses fewer oil glands (bã tuyến dầu) meaning it’s naturally drier and more prone to dehydration.
  2. Accelerated Aging: The skin around the eyes ages at a faster rate than other areas of the face, making it more susceptible to wrinkles and fine lines.

These factors necessitate a specialized approach to skincare in this region.

Types of Eye Creams

The video categorizes eye creams into two main types:

  1. Basic Hydrating Eye Creams: These creams focus solely on providing moisture to the delicate eye area. The speaker mentions an example costing “a few hundred thousand” (VND - Vietnamese Dong, implying a relatively affordable price point). These are suitable for basic hydration and are a minimum requirement for eye area care.
  2. Eye Creams with Active Ingredients: These creams go beyond hydration and incorporate ingredients designed to address aging concerns. Examples given include Vitamin C and Retinol (tin). However, a crucial point is made: these ingredients are present in low concentrations to minimize irritation due to the sensitivity of the eye area.

Recommended Skincare Routine Based on Age

The speaker provides a tiered recommendation based on age and skincare needs:

  • Minimum Care (All Ages): Utilize a dedicated hydrating eye cream to maintain moisture levels.
  • Enhanced Care (Age 30+): For individuals aged 30 and above (tầm bách đổ ra), the speaker recommends incorporating an eye cream containing active ingredients like Vitamin C or Retinol. This is presented as a proactive step to combat the accelerated aging process in this area.
